Share via


IUpdateDefinition<ParentT> Schnittstelle

Definition

Die gesamte Definition einer Netzwerksicherheitsregel als Teil eines Updates für Netzwerksicherheitsgruppen.

public interface IUpdateDefinition<ParentT> : Microsoft.Azure.Management.Network.Fluent.NetworkSecurityRule.UpdateDefinition.IBlank<ParentT>, Microsoft.Azure.Management.Network.Fluent.NetworkSecurityRule.UpdateDefinition.IWithAttach<ParentT>, Microsoft.Azure.Management.Network.Fluent.NetworkSecurityRule.UpdateDefinition.IWithDestinationAddressOrSecurityGroup<ParentT>, Microsoft.Azure.Management.Network.Fluent.NetworkSecurityRule.UpdateDefinition.IWithDestinationPort<ParentT>, Microsoft.Azure.Management.Network.Fluent.NetworkSecurityRule.UpdateDefinition.IWithDirectionAccess<ParentT>, Microsoft.Azure.Management.Network.Fluent.NetworkSecurityRule.UpdateDefinition.IWithProtocol<ParentT>, Microsoft.Azure.Management.Network.Fluent.NetworkSecurityRule.UpdateDefinition.IWithSourceAddressOrSecurityGroup<ParentT>, Microsoft.Azure.Management.Network.Fluent.NetworkSecurityRule.UpdateDefinition.IWithSourcePort<ParentT>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ChildResource.Update.IInUpdate<ParentT>
type IUpdateDefinition<'ParentT> = interface
    interface IBlank<'ParentT>
    interface IWithDirectionAccess<'ParentT>
    interface IWithSourceAddressOrSecurityGroup<'ParentT>
    interface IWithSourcePort<'ParentT>
    interface IWithDestinationAddressOrSecurityGroup<'ParentT>
    interface IWithDestinationPort<'ParentT>
    interface IWithProtocol<'ParentT>
    interface IWithAttach<'ParentT>
    interface IInUpdate<'ParentT>
Public Interface IUpdateDefinition(Of ParentT)
Implements IBlank(Of ParentT), IInUpdate(Of ParentT), IWithAttach(Of ParentT), IWithDestinationAddressOrSecurityGroup(Of ParentT), IWithDestinationPort(Of ParentT), IWithDirectionAccess(Of ParentT), IWithProtocol(Of ParentT), IWithSourceAddressOrSecurityGroup(Of ParentT), IWithSourcePort(Of ParentT)

Typparameter

ParentT

Der Rückgabetyp des endgültigen UpdateDefinitionStages.WithAttach.attach().

Implementiert

Methoden

AllowInbound()

Lässt eingehenden Datenverkehr zu.

(Geerbt von IWithDirectionAccess<ParentT>)
AllowOutbound()

Lässt ausgehenden Datenverkehr zu.

(Geerbt von IWithDirectionAccess<ParentT>)
Attach()

Die gesamte Definition einer Netzwerksicherheitsregel als Teil eines Updates für Netzwerksicherheitsgruppen.

(Geerbt von IInUpdate<ParentT>)
DenyInbound()

Blockiert eingehenden Datenverkehr.

(Geerbt von IWithDirectionAccess<ParentT>)
DenyOutbound()

Blockiert ausgehenden Datenverkehr.

(Geerbt von IWithDirectionAccess<ParentT>)
FromAddress(String)

Gibt das Präfix für die Quelladresse des Datenverkehrs an, für das diese Regel gilt.

(Geerbt von IWithSourceAddressOrSecurityGroup<ParentT>)
FromAddresses(String[])

Gibt die Präfixe für die Datenverkehrsquelladresse an, für die diese Regel gilt.

(Geerbt von IWithSourceAddressOrSecurityGroup<ParentT>)
FromAnyAddress()

Gibt an, dass die Regel für jede Quelladresse des Datenverkehrs gilt.

(Geerbt von IWithSourceAddressOrSecurityGroup<ParentT>)
FromAnyPort()

Bewirkt, dass diese Regel auf jeden Quellport angewendet wird.

(Geerbt von IWithSourcePort<ParentT>)
FromPort(Int32)

Gibt den Quellport an, für den diese Regel gilt.

(Geerbt von IWithSourcePort<ParentT>)
FromPortRange(Int32, Int32)

Gibt den Quellportbereich an, für den diese Regel gilt.

(Geerbt von IWithSourcePort<ParentT>)
FromPortRanges(String[])

Gibt die Quellportbereiche an, auf die diese Regel angewendet wird.

(Geerbt von IWithSourcePort<ParentT>)
ToAddress(String)

Gibt den Adressbereich des Datenverkehrsziels an, für den diese Regel gilt.

(Geerbt von IWithDestinationAddressOrSecurityGroup<ParentT>)
ToAddresses(String[])

Gibt die Präfixe für die Zieladresse des Datenverkehrs an, für die diese Regel gilt.

(Geerbt von IWithDestinationAddressOrSecurityGroup<ParentT>)
ToAnyAddress()

Wendet die Regel auf alle Zieladressen des Datenverkehrs an.

(Geerbt von IWithDestinationAddressOrSecurityGroup<ParentT>)
ToAnyPort()

Diese Regel gilt für jeden Zielport.

(Geerbt von IWithDestinationPort<ParentT>)
ToPort(Int32)

Gibt den Zielport an, für den diese Regel gilt.

(Geerbt von IWithDestinationPort<ParentT>)
ToPortRange(Int32, Int32)

Gibt den Zielportbereich an, für den diese Regel gilt.

(Geerbt von IWithDestinationPort<ParentT>)
ToPortRanges(String[])

Gibt die Zielportbereiche an, für die diese Regel gilt.

(Geerbt von IWithDestinationPort<ParentT>)
WithAnyProtocol()

Bewirkt, dass diese Regel auf jedes unterstützte Protokoll angewendet wird.

(Geerbt von IWithProtocol<ParentT>)
WithDescription(String)

Gibt eine Beschreibung für diese Sicherheitsregel an.

(Geerbt von IWithAttach<ParentT>)
WithDestinationApplicationSecurityGroup(String)

Legt die als Ziel angegebene Anwendungssicherheitsgruppe fest.

(Geerbt von IWithDestinationAddressOrSecurityGroup<ParentT>)
WithPriority(Int32)

Gibt die Priorität an, die dieser Regel zugewiesen werden soll. Sicherheitsregeln werden in der Reihenfolge ihrer zugewiesenen Priorität angewendet.

(Geerbt von IWithAttach<ParentT>)
WithProtocol(SecurityRuleProtocol)

Gibt das Protokoll an, für das diese Regel gilt.

(Geerbt von IWithProtocol<ParentT>)
WithSourceApplicationSecurityGroup(String)

Legt die als Quelle angegebene Anwendungssicherheitsgruppe fest.

(Geerbt von IWithSourceAddressOrSecurityGroup<ParentT>)

Gilt für: